Assistant Manager, State Payroll
Required Qualifications (as evidenced by an attached resume):
Bachelor's degree (foreign equivalent or higher). In lieu of the degree, a combination of education and payroll experience totaling four (4) years may be considered. Four (4) years of full-time experience processing payroll. Customer service experience. Proficiency in Microsoft Word and Excel, with experience using Microsoft PowerPoint.
Preferred Qualifications:
Experience in processing executive payroll. Supervisory experience. Experience working with tax and deduction processing. Familiarity with INS, IRS, and New York State taxation regulations. Experience implementing IRS withholding requirements for non-resident aliens and determining tax treaty eligibility. Prior payroll experience in a higher education environment. Experience processing payroll using New York State's Payroll system (PAYSERV).
Brief Description of Duties:
The Assistant Manager is responsible for overseeing the State Payroll team and ensuring the accurate and timely processing of all state payroll transactions for the University, Hospital, and Long Island State Veteran's Home. Payroll issues are escalated to the Assistant Manager for review and resolution. The Assistant Manager conducts annual performance evaluations, addresses performance concerns, and provides regular updates to the team, including guidance on Payroll Bulletins issued by the Office of the State Comptroller (OSC). The incumbent will oversee the high-profile Executive Payroll and approve salary advances and paycheck reversals. Attention to detail and demonstrated ability to manage confidential information responsibly. The successful candidate may be required to work additional hours during peak periods to support team needs and ensure operational success. They should also possess demonstrated excellence in customer service and communication skills.
Supervise the Payroll Analyst, Payroll Leads, and Payroll Examiner. Ensure the timely and accurate completion of all payroll transactions for the University, Hospital, and Long Island State Veteran's Home. Review and assign workload as appropriate. Certify the biweekly state and student payrolls. Review corrections issued by the OSC and ensure appropriate follow-up actions. Report suspected payroll-related fraud to the Office of the Treasury and the University Police Department and assist with investigations as needed.
Support the payroll team by assisting with daily payroll processing activities, particularly during peak periods. Review team workloads and reassign tasks as necessary to ensure equitable distribution. Review processes and procedures to identify improvements that enhance efficiency.
Review, interpret, and ensure communication of OSC payroll bulletins to the campus community. Provide updates and directions to payroll staff based on these bulletins. Oversee all State payroll-related content maintained on departmental websites, training materials, and other resources. Create and maintain internal payroll procedure documentation and ensure its distribution to the team.
Review and approve Salary Advance requests to ensure alignment with university policy. Review and approve paycheck reversals to ensure consistency with departmental practices and confirm that a reversal is the most appropriate method for recouping funds.
Process tax refunds, calculate Social Security and Medicare deficiencies, and update FICA taxes. Collaborate with OSC to request and issue corrected W-2 forms to employees.
Interpret, monitor, and enforce IRS withholding requirements for non-resident aliens (NRA). Conduct substantial presence tests, determine tax treaty eligibility, and provide guidance to departments and employees. Process the NRA scholarship payroll.
Oversee the processing of the Executive Payroll. Calculate salary gross ups and report automobile personal use values and housing staff allowances.
Other duties or projects as assigned as appropriate to rank and departmental mission.
